    Love the Philippines, it's where my mom is from! It struggles with overpopulation and plummeting biodiversity. Many of the newly discovered animals are immediately placed on the critically endangered list as their habitat is actively claimed by farms and suburbs, for instance. Scientists are quickly trying to catalogue animals and plants before they are gone for good. For perspective, the Philippines is the size of the state of Nevada (pop. 3 million), and the Philippines has 120 million and still growing fast. Even with the volcanoes and typhoons, it should be paradise on Earth, but it's disappearing incredibly fast. Support local environmental activists that work endlessly with local communities to preserve the little forest and fresh water habit that remains. Younger Filipinos have their work cut out for them as poor government policy has left the environment in near shambles in the face of climate change. The Philippines is truly a magical place, one of the few places on Earth where life flourishes (as evidenced by biodiversity), all with incredible culture!
